如何解决Android:在onListItemClick内获取MotionEvent
| 我有一个ListActivity,我想对 onListItemClick(ListView l,View v,int position,long id) 。 但我也想知道用户是单击屏幕的左侧还是右侧。 我可以从onListItemclicked方法中获取MotionEvent吗? 我有一个ListView。在每一行中,左边都有一个名称,右边有一个平均投票。当用户单击左侧的一行时,我要加载一个显示有关名称信息的活动。当用户单击行的右侧时,我想加载一个活动,让用户对名称进行投票。我想使用onListItemClick(ListView l,View v,int position,long id)来获取我所在的行,因为它很容易。但是我怎么知道用户是单击左侧还是右侧。 我可以问一些对象当前正在处理的MotionEvent吗? 谢谢!解决方法
将左视图和右视图都设置为“ 0”怎么办?如有必要,您可以填充视图,以便它们比当前覆盖更多的行。这样,当您在“中性”区域单击时,您仍会收到“ 1”字样。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。